Overview of Air Cooled Water Chillers
Air cooled water chillers are commonly used within HVAC systems to extract heat from water via a refrigeration cycle and disperse it into the surrounding air. Unlike water-cooled systems, they operate without cooling towers, which simplifies both installation and maintenance.
In industrial settings, air cooled industrial water chillers are used to regulate temperatures for machinery, production processes, and entire facilities. Their self-contained design makes them ideal for locations with restricted water availability or where a less complex setup is preferred.
How Air Cooled Industrial Water Chillers Function
These chillers rely on four essential components: an evaporator, compressor, condenser, and expansion valve. Heat is drawn from the water within the evaporator and transferred through the refrigerant cycle. The condenser releases this heat into the air using fans, removing the need for additional water sources.
Industrial systems are designed for durability and consistent operation. Many include corrosion-resistant components, energy-efficient compressors, and advanced control panels to support dependable performance.

Installation and Ongoing Maintenance
Proper installation supports optimal system performance. This includes ensuring sufficient airflow around the unit and allowing access for maintenance.
Regular servicing, including cleaning coils and checking refrigerant levels, helps maintain efficiency. A structured maintenance plan can reduce downtime and extend system lifespan.
Common Questions
What distinguishes air cooled from water cooled chillers?
Air cooled chillers release heat directly into the air, whereas water cooled systems rely on water from cooling towers. Air cooled options are typically easier to install and maintain.
Are air cooled industrial water chillers suitable for outdoor use?
Yes, most systems are designed for external installation and can function in varied weather conditions.
What is the energy efficiency of air cooled water chillers?
Efficiency depends on system design and usage patterns, though modern units often include features to manage energy use effectively.
Which industries use air cooled water chillers most often?
Sectors including manufacturing, food production, pharmaceuticals, and data centres commonly use these systems.
How frequently should maintenance be carried out?
Maintenance is typically recommended every six to twelve months, depending on system usage and conditions.
Can these systems adapt to changing cooling loads?
Yes, many systems are designed to vary output based on demand, improving efficiency and performance.
